Why you should start considering Azure Batch for some of your Dynamics 365 Business Central cloud workloads

Writing on the Stefano Demiliani’s NAV Blog, Demiliani noted that at the Dynamics 365 Business Central 2021 Wave 1 Launch event, Dmitry Chadayev described the improvements that Microsoft has made on the tenant’s database export feature.

These improvements involved the underlying technology for having a more reliable and performant way of exporting the tenant database when this database grows in size during time.

Demiliani pointed out that previously, the database export was handled by using the standard database export feature from Azure SQL. However now there’s new service that uses Azure Batch to handle the export of these databases more reliably.

In his blog post, Demiliani explained in detail how to use Azure Batch for some of your Dynamics 365 Business Central cloud workloads.
